The Kremlin has said that the criticism by the West of President Vladimir Putin's announcement to deploy nuclear tactical weapons in Belarus won't influence its decision and Russia will not change its plans. The move however, has reportedly put Volodymyr Zelensky in a huddle. Zelensky's ally and Ukrainian MP David Arakhamia has now warned that Ukraine may need to conscript even more people into military service to potentially fight against Belarus.
